What Esports Tournaments Will Be There in 2024?
2024 will be a busy year in the esports calendar. Organizers have ensured you enjoy breathtaking scenes in various disciplines throughout the year. Here is what to expect from January to December.
January Esports Tournaments
Look out for the following competitive actions in January:
- The League of Legends Regional Series
This will happen globally from mid-January, with LEC Winter and LCK Spring competitions kicking off of January, respectively.
- The ALGS Split 1 Pro League
The series will feature group stages starting on the 21st of January. This tournament will feature EMEA, APAC South and North, and North American teams. The top two teams in each group will proceed to the quarters and the best four to the semis. In addition, the winners will battle out for the prestigious award and a $1,000 cash prize.
- IEM Katowice 2024
This will be the first CS: GO premier tournament from late January to the 11th of February. Expect to see top teams like Navi, FaZe Clan, and Team Vitality battle for a $1,000,000 pool prize. Other tournaments to watch out for in January include the Call of Duty Major 1 and the Rocket League Championship Series.
February Esports Tournaments
This month will see the following events played:
- Dota’s Dream League Season Invitational runs from the 25th of February to the 10th of March. The prize pool is set at $1,000,000.
- Brazil will host the elite Rainbow Six Siege tournament, Six Invitational, on the 13th of February. A prize pool of $3,000,000 is up for grabs, with 20 international teams expected to compete.
Esport Events to be Played in March
- PGL Copenhagen 2024 Major
If you are a fan of Counter-Strike Global Offensive, you must be aware that the title has now been modified to CS2. Valve Cooperation has organized a major international event in Copenhagen to boost its popularity.
Top teams worldwide will be battling for a share of the $1.25m tournament. There will be regional qualifiers selected from the Regional Major series.
- The Valorant Champions Tour, VCT 2024 Masters
It is the first of Valorant’s events scheduled for 8th-24th March to be played in Madrid. China will host several playoffs.
- PUBG Mobile Global 2024
This will be the first LAN global event sponsored by PUBG. It comes with $500,000 to be grabbed that will be played from late March into May.
Other competitive scenes to be hosted in March are the CDL Major II, sponsored by Mirema Heretics, and the FFWS Sea Spring, organized by Garena.
What Esports Are Scheduled in April?
You will witness three major events in April:
- The ESL One Birmingham, a Dota 2 tournament, will run from the 22nd of April, competing for a share of the $1m prize. There will be an ESL pro tour with regional qualifiers to get to the final event.
- Valve plans to bring back the elite Counter-Strike contest in China dubbed the IEM China 2024, which will be played from 8th-14th April.
- Watch out for the ESL Pro League Season 19, a prestigious Counter-Strike series from the 23rd of April.
Second Quarter of 2024
Now that we are done with the first quarter, let’s look at esports competitions from May to August.
Esports Tournaments in May
- Mid-Season Invitational 2024
League of Legends has organized an MSI tour featuring a new ranking. Winners will qualify for the World Championship and the regionals. The MSI will be played in Chengdu, China, starting 1st-19th May.
- VCT Shanghai Masters
Valorant will have another exciting international tournament, VCT. This will be the first regional league competition in China.
Look out for the DreamLeague Season 23 (ESL’s Pro Tour by Dota 2), which will be played online, and the CDL Major III.
Esports Slated for June
- ESL has organized the Snapdragon PRO Series as a roadmap for the ML: BB, with the first match happening in early summer.
- The CDL Major IV will be the final CDL tournament, followed by the CDL 2024 Championship. Details about the venue are yet to be revealed by the organizers, but Texas might be the speculated host.
Any Esports Tournaments in July?
So far, no esports event is scheduled in July, but you can look out for the Mid-Season Tournament. The series is a continuation of the PUBG Mobile World Invitational to be played in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. Unlike previous competitions, this event has a higher prize pool, approximately $3m.
August Esports Events Calendar
One of the most prestigious Valorant events in August is the VCT 2024 Champions. It will be an elite title where participants hope to be crowned the world champions.
Another notable tournament in August is the IEM Cologne 2024, a prestigious CS2 event that will be played at the LANXESS arena.
Esports Scheduled for the Final Quarter
- Watch out for the World of Tanks championship hosted in London from the 25th of September to the 2nd of November. The play-ins will be in Berlin, and playoffs in Paris.
- Counter-Strike has another exciting event in September, the ESL Pro League Season 20, with the finalist qualifying for the IEM Katowice challenge.
October Esports Competitions
There will be two main events confirmed:
- The SnapDragon Pro Series is a regional league culminating in the M6 World Championship.
- The Dream League Season 24 will be witnessed in the Dota 2 scene. It will be the penultimate event of the EPT season three that will pave the way for ESL One Asia at the end of 2024.
Esports that Will be Played in November
- The FFWS Global Finals is the ultimate contest in the Free Fire genre, featuring the best teams globally that will be played in India.
- The PUBG Mobile Championship has a $3M prize pool and will be played in the UK.
- The BLAST premier World Final is an event inspired by the Counter-Strike esports community scheduled in Abu Dhabi.
As the year ends, there will be multiple esports disciplines to be played in December, including:
- The M6 World Championship
- The Perfect World Shanghai Major 2024 is a Counter-Strike China-based title.
- The ESL One Asia will be Dota 2’s global LAN event of the EPT Season 3.
